Start with the roofing system, not the panels
A lot of sales conversations begin with panel brand names. That is reasonable, due to the fact that components are visible and simple to compare. However knowledgeable home owners and specialists know the roof covering ought to come first.
Before you even compare installers, ask a straightforward question: is your roofing system a good prospect today? If the roofing system has just a few years of life left, solar might still make good sense, but you need to analyze reroofing prior to installation. Eliminating and reinstalling panels later on adds price, and not every firm handles that process well. A solid installer will certainly elevate this problem early, also if it slows down the sale.
The exact same puts on shielding. A fully grown tree on the south or west side of a residential property can substantially transform output over the course of a year. In Chico areas with older landscaping, that is not a small detail. Good installers make use of color analysis devices and discuss how morning color varies from late mid-day shade, just how seasonal sunlight angles influence production, and whether trimming is worthwhile. Weak ones provide you a production estimate that thinks cleaner sun exposure than your roof covering actually gets.
Roof pitch, orientation, attic air flow, and the problem of the electric panel all matter too. If a sales representative winds past those information and actions directly to funding, that is an indication to slow down down.
The ideal installer is commonly the most effective task manager
Homeowners commonly think of a solar business as a construction crew. It is much more accurate to think about it as a project supervisor that also carries out building. A domestic solar work touches style, structural review, electrical engineering, utility control, local permitting, procurement, organizing, inspections, and final commissioning.
That is why 2 firms utilizing comparable devices can provide really different experiences.
One company may submit plans quickly, respond to city comments rapidly, and interact routine adjustments prior to you have to ask. An additional may leave you questioning for weeks whether licenses were submitted in all. The panels on the roofing might look comparable in a picture, yet the 2nd task costs more in stress and delay.
Ask who handles each phase. Some firms offer the task and then hand it off to subcontractors you never ever fulfill up until setup day. Subcontracting is not instantly poor, yet it does need more examination. You need to recognize that is liable if the roofing system flashes leak, if channel runs appearance unpleasant, or if the monitoring application never readies up correctly.
The toughest solar installers Chico has have a tendency to be extremely clear about this chain of obligation. They can tell you that makes the system, that mounts it, who pulls permits, and that deals with post-install service. Vagueness here usually develops into frustrations later.

What to ask when you contrast proposals
Most proposals look brightened. They reveal rows of smooth panels, a forecasted savings number, and a regular monthly settlement that shows up convenient. The problem is that many home owners contrast the incorrect things. A quote is not just a rate. It is a package of assumptions.
The fastest method to tell whether you are handling a major expert is to ask certain concerns and see how they respond.
- What presumptions are you using for yearly usage, utility rate escalation, and system degradation?
- Who executes the setup job, your employees or subcontractors?
- What tools is included, down to inverter design, racking system, and keeping an eye on platform?
- What is covered under handiwork service warranty, and that handles service phone calls after installation?
- If my roof covering needs job, panel removal, or electric upgrades, how are those prices handled?
Good firms invite these concerns. They respond to straight and in simple language. Weak ones pivot back to month-to-month repayment, tax obligation motivations, or a limited-time offer.
Pay close attention to production quotes. Two installers may suggest systems of comparable dimension yet forecast especially various result. That gap does not constantly indicate one firm is lying, yet it does indicate someone is utilizing various assumptions about shading, azimuth, tilt, or regional weather condition information. Ask them to clarify the distinction. The way they describe it tells you a lot.
Pricing is very important, yet economical solar can get expensive
Price per watt works, however it is not the entire story. A reduced rate might mirror lean operations and reasonable margins, or it may reflect rushed style, low-grade labor, bad service capacity, or tools options that are hard to support later.
I have actually seen house owners focus on a quote that came in numerous thousand bucks listed below rivals, just to discover later that the contract excluded a primary panel upgrade, did not account for roofing system fixings around mounting factors, or utilized a system layout that pushed panels right into partial shade to hit a larger promoted size. The preliminary savings disappeared quickly.
The opposite mistake happens also. A high quote is not evidence of top quality. Some companies cost high because they can, not since they give far better design or assistance. The goal is not to locate the most inexpensive or most pricey installer. It is to comprehend why the cost is what it is.
For household solar, it aids to contrast the total set up price, the approximated yearly production, the guarantee terms, and the scope of consisted of work. If one quote is significantly reduced, ask what has been omitted. If one is drastically greater, ask what justifies the premium.
A beneficial gut check is whether the proposition really feels crafted or just marketed. An engineered proposition specifies, constrained by your actual roofing and usage account, and sincere concerning trade-offs. A sales-driven proposal often tends to be smoother, much less detailed, and more focused on necessity than fit.
Warranties just matter if the company can recognize them
Many property owners listen to "25-year warranty" and assume they are fully shielded. Solar service warranties are a lot more complex than that.
Panel producers generally offer product and efficiency service warranties. Inverter companies supply their own insurance coverage, typically with various terms. The installer might likewise offer a handiwork warranty that covers roofing system penetrations, placing, electrical wiring, and installation-related concerns. These are separate protections, and they are just as helpful as the business standing behind them.
When you assess service warranty language, seek clearness on labor, not just components. A stopped working component under maker guarantee is much less calming if you still have to pay for analysis check outs, roof accessibility, shipping, or reinstallation labor. Ask that functions as your supporter if an element falls short. The installer needs to not just state, "Call the maker." They ought to describe their service process.

Pay focus to the electrical details
Solar sales discussions often reveal panels and financial savings graphs. A number of the top quality distinctions, however, are concealed in electric job you might never ever discover unless something goes wrong.
Look at just how the installer speak about avenue positioning, roofing infiltrations, labeling, separate areas, and panel integration. Clean work is not simply cosmetic. It usually shows discipline. A crew that takes satisfaction abreast, weather sealing, and tidy circuitry is typically a crew that adheres to procedure in much less noticeable areas too.
Your main service panel is worthy of unique focus. Older homes in Chico may require upgrades, derating, or load-side link preparing to fit solar securely and lawfully. If battery storage is part of the style, affiliation becomes a lot more entailed. You desire an installer who can describe this plainly, not one who treats your panel as an afterthought.
There is additionally an actual distinction in between business that just install to minimum code and business that plan ahead. The much better ones intend service right into the system. They avoid producing roofing system formats that complicate future maintenance, and they put equipment where specialists can in fact access it later on without transforming routine service right into a half-day ordeal.

Financing transforms the business economics greater than the equipment occasionally does
A home owner paying cash and a homeowner funding with a long-lasting finance can review the exact same system extremely in a different way. Rates of interest, dealership fees, financing term, and prepayment framework all form the real expense of going solar.
This is where numerous or else clever purchasers obtain floundered. They compare month-to-month repayments as opposed to complete project price. That can make a pricey funding package appearance appealing due to the fact that the payment is stretched out. A professional installer needs to agree to go over cash price, financed rate, and exactly how different financing frameworks influence long-lasting savings.
Lease and power acquisition arrangements may likewise enter the image. For some homes, they use a reduced obstacle to entrance. For others, they complicate home resale and lower the monetary upside compared to ownership. There is nobody right solution, however there ought to be a candid conversation. If a sales representative avoids total-cost mathematics and keeps steering everything back to "lower than your present utility bill," proceed carefully.
People searching solar installation business near me are frequently doing so due to the fact that they want a fast solution. Financing is where fast solutions obtain expensive. Slow down and read every figure.
Beware of extra-large promises
Solar can cut electrical costs dramatically. In some homes, it can virtually offset yearly use. That does not mean every roofing sustains a "no costs" outcome, and any kind of installer who guarantees that result without careful utility analysis is overselling.
Usage patterns issue. If you heat with electrical power, charge an EV, run a pool pump, or anticipate house need to increase, your suitable system might look extremely various from your neighbor's. The best installers account for future adjustments. If you tell them an EV is most likely within two years, they should talk about whether to size for that now, leave area for development, or pair solar with effectiveness enhancements first.
A practical business also explains the restrictions of internet metering or whatever payment structure applies in your utility region at the time of installation. Exported electrical power and on-site usage are not always valued the same way. That impacts payback and battery value. Straight talk here is a good sign.
A list of red flags
Some indication turn up so constantly that they deserve unique attention.
- The salesperson pressures you to authorize the exact same day to protect a vanishing incentive.
- The proposition does not have specific devices details or utilizes unclear language like "or comparable."
- The company can not plainly discuss who takes care of authorizations, installation, and guarantee service.
- Savings forecasts count on aggressive utility rising cost of living presumptions without disclosure.
- Questions concerning roofing system problem, shielding, or panel upgrades are combed aside.
None of these factors alone confirms a business is unqualified, yet with each other they usually signify a sales-first operation.

What are the disadvantages of solar panels in Chico?
Solar panels require a significant upfront investment and may not be suitable for every roof. Energy production decreases during cloudy weather and stops at night without battery storage. Roof repairs may require temporary panel removal. Equipment such as inverters may need replacement before the panels reach the end of their lifespan.

What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Chico?
Most solar panels have an average lifespan of 25 to 30 years. Their electricity production gradually declines over time, but they often continue operating beyond the warranty period. Routine maintenance can help maintain efficiency throughout their lifespan. Inverters typically require replacement after about 10 to 15 years.
